Transaction dfbde61d39eea009a402fb15b5c4bd606e26c5668dd300023ed107e2845e78bc

98 Input
2 Outputs
  • dfbde61d39eea009a402fb15b5c4bd606e26c5668dd300023ed107e2845e78bc:0
  • value  1049689
    address  3LXZorBZhTKAJScFX8KMyCow2XVts9c1TB
  • dfbde61d39eea009a402fb15b5c4bd606e26c5668dd300023ed107e2845e78bc:1
  • value  696282096
    address  3QAgd3km4gxauRHvsGtF4ZXaPrvzwsSLMU